    La Auditoria de Gestión y su incidencia en las decisiones en el otorgamiento de créditos de la Cooperativa de Ahorro y Crédito Campesina “COOPAC” Ltda.
    (Universidad Técnica de Ambato. Facultad de Contabilidad y Auditoría. Carrera Contabilidad y Auditoría, 2016-11) Cañar Cerón, Jessica Jessenia; DT - Tobar Vasco, Guido Herman
    Currently the cooperative has won a major role in the financial system, it is why the need to know what is the reason why the credit system is weak and its policies and procedures are detected are not being properly implemented within the lending process causing high rates of delinquency is one of the most important factors in institutional management, it is evident that growth it difficult to achieve a balance and financial sustainability of the institution. One of the most important situations of the institution are the decisions at the time of lending in the implementation of activities and the study and evaluation of customer payment capacity. In addition inducing executives to adopt measures to improve the financial position against possible default by a debtor. The purpose of the research is to assess whether there is need for a management audit in its credit system to determine the level of effectiveness, efficiency, economy and ethics that are managing and fulfilling the activities of the processes according to the rules internal Cooperative, then improve them through specific recommendations to avoid misplaced credits.
